This is not a generic casino review — this is a practical operator manual for Mega riches login players. This guide provides a technical deep-dive into the platform’s systems, from the initial authentication process and account configuration to performing precise wagering requirement calculations and navigating the full suite of financial and support operations. The objective is to equip you with the systematic knowledge required to interact with the casino’s infrastructure efficiently and securely.

Getting Ready

Before initiating the authentication sequence, ensure your operational environment is correctly configured. A failed preparation phase is a leading cause of login and transactional errors.

  • System Compatibility Check: Confirm your device’s operating system (OS) and web browser are updated to their latest stable versions. The platform is optimized for Chrome 115+, Firefox 110+, and Safari 16+ on desktop, and recent iOS/Android browsers for mobile.
  • Network Configuration: Use a stable, private internet connection. Public Wi-Fi networks often have restrictive firewalls or port blocking that can interfere with the secure socket layer (SSL) handshake required for login. A personal mobile hotspot is a more reliable alternative if on the move.
  • Credential Verification: Have your registered email address and password ready. The system is case-sensitive. If you use a password manager, ensure it is unlocked and configured to auto-fill for the correct domain.
  • Two-Factor Authentication (2FA) Device: If you have enabled 2FA—which is strongly recommended—ensure your authenticator app (e.g., Google Authenticator, Authy) is accessible, or your SMS-receiving device is powered on and has signal.
  • Documentation for KYC: While not needed for the login itself, having your identification document (passport, driver’s license) and a recent proof of address (utility bill, bank statement) digitized and ready will expedite the account verification process required before your first withdrawal.

Account Setup

Follow this sequential procedure to establish your player account. Skipping or incorrectly performing any step may result in account verification delays or bonus forfeiture.

  1. Navigate to the official casino homepage using your browser. Bookmark this page to prevent phishing.
  2. Locate and click the ‘Sign Up’ or ‘Register’ button, typically found in the top-right corner of the interface.
  3. In the registration form, input your personal details exactly as they appear on your official ID. Discrepancies between your registered name and your ID will cause KYC failure. Use a valid, active email address you control.
  4. Create a strong password. The minimum requirement is typically 8 characters with uppercase, lowercase, and a number. We recommend using a passphrase or a password generated and stored by a reputable manager.
  5. If prompted, enter any valid promotional code at this stage. This is often the only time you can apply a sign-up bonus code.
  6. Read and accept the Terms and Conditions. Pay particular attention to the bonus wagering requirements, game contribution percentages, and withdrawal limits.
  7. Complete the registration by clicking the confirmation link sent to your email. This verifies your email ownership and activates the account.
  8. Log in for the first time using your new credentials. You will likely be prompted to begin the identity verification (KYC) process in your account profile section.

Calculating Your Bonus

Understanding the real value and cost of a bonus requires precise mathematical modeling. The core formula revolves around the Expected Value (EV) after meeting wagering requirements (WR). Let’s model a common offer: a 100% deposit match up to €100 with a 35x wagering requirement on the bonus amount.

Assumptions: You deposit €100, receiving a €100 bonus. Total balance: €200. Wagering Requirement (WR) = Bonus (€100) x 35 = €3,500. You play a slot game with a 96.5% Return to Player (RTP). The game contribution to wagering is 100%.

Key Formula: Expected Loss from Wagering = Total Wagering Amount × (1 – RTP)

Step 1: Calculate Expected Loss.
Expected Loss = €3,500 × (1 – 0.965) = €3,500 × 0.035 = €122.50.

Step 2: Calculate Net Bonus Value.
Net Value = Bonus Amount – Expected Loss = €100 – €122.50 = -€22.50.

This model shows a negative expected value of -€22.50. The bonus, in this pure statistical model, is not profitable. However, variance plays a huge role. To have a >50% probability of converting the bonus to cash, you need a smaller expected loss. A more practical break-even point is when Expected Loss ≈ Bonus Amount. Solving for the required RTP:
€100 = €3,500 × (1 – RTP) => (1 – RTP) = €100 / €3,500 ≈ 0.02857 => RTP ≈ 0.9714 or 97.14%. You would need to find a game with an RTP exceeding 97.14% to have a positive model. This illustrates why reading game-specific RTP and contribution rates is non-negotiable.

Mega Riches Casino welcome bonus offer details and wagering requirements
Visual breakdown of a typical welcome bonus package showing match percentage, maximum bonus, and associated wagering terms.

Game Contribution Analysis

Game Category Typical Wagering Contribution Average RTP Range Notes & Strategy Impact
Slots (Main Providers) 100% 94% – 97% Primary tool for clearing WR. Target games with published RTP >96%.
Table Blackjack 5% – 20% 99.2% – 99.7% (Basic Strategy) High RTP but low contribution makes it inefficient for bonus clearing.
Roulette (European) 10% – 20% 97.3% Better contribution than blackjack, but house edge is fixed and higher.
Video Poker (Jacks or Better) 5% – 20% 99.54% (Full-Pay) Excellent RTP if perfect play, but contribution is often severely restricted.
Live Dealer Games 0% – 10% ~99% (Blackjack) Often contribute little or nothing. Check terms explicitly.
Craps 5% – 10% 98.5%+ (on pass line) Rarely optimal due to complex rules and low contribution.
Baccarat 10% – 20% 98.94% (Banker bet) Moderate option if slots are not desired.
Specialty Games (Keno, Scratch) 0% – 5% 80% – 95% Avoid for wagering. Very low RTP and contribution.

Payment Methods

The platform’s payment gateway supports multiple transaction protocols. Each has distinct technical parameters affecting processing time and success rate. E-wallets (Skrill, Neteller) typically facilitate the fastest transactions due to pre-verified accounts, with deposits crediting instantly and withdrawals processing in 0-24 hours. Debit/Credit card (Visa, Mastercard) withdrawals involve more intermediary banks and can take 1-5 business days. Bank Transfers are the slowest, often 3-7 business days, but have the highest perceived trust and limits. Always initiate a withdrawal to the same method and account used for deposit where possible; this is a standard anti-fraud measure and can significantly speed up processing.

Security

The platform’s security posture is built on multiple layers. The primary defense is TLS 1.2/1.3 encryption (signified by HTTPS in the address bar and a padlock icon) for all data in transit. Your password should be hashed and salted at rest on their servers. The most critical user-controlled security layer is enabling Two-Factor Authentication (2FA) in the account settings. This adds a time-based one-time password (TOTP) requirement, making account compromise via credential theft vastly more difficult. Be aware that the casino operates under a Curacao license. For players in the EU and Nordic regions, this is a crucial distinction: unlike casinos licensed by the Malta Gaming Authority (MGA) or local national regulators, winnings from Curacao-licensed operators may be subject to declaration and local income tax in your country of residence. It is your responsibility to understand your local tax laws.

Support Guide

To resolve issues efficiently, diagnose the problem category and use the appropriate support channel with clear, technical information.

  1. Login Failure / Account Locked: Use the ‘Forgot Password’ function first. If unsuccessful, contact live chat or email support. Provide your registered email and any error code displayed.
  2. Bonus Not Credited: Check your active bonuses in the ‘Cashier’ or ‘Promotions’ section. If missing, contact support via live chat. Have your deposit transaction ID and the exact bonus code you used ready.
  3. Game Malfunction (e.g., game freeze, incorrect payout): Do not close the game window. Immediately take a screenshot showing the game ID, timestamp, and bet details. Contact live chat and submit the screenshot. They will escalate to the game provider.
  4. Withdrawal Pending / Delayed: First, check your account’s ‘Verification’ status. If not fully verified, upload required documents. If verified, contact support via live chat for a status update. Ask if any additional internal checks are being performed.
  5. Suspected Unfair Game Result: Formal complaints must be submitted via email to the support team for logging and investigation. Include all relevant data: game name, round ID, timestamp, your account name, and a description of the perceived discrepancy.

Pro Tips

Maximizing your gameplay efficiency revolves around RTP and volatility selection. For pure, long-term value, focus on high RTP, low-to-medium volatility slots from providers like NetEnt (Blood Suckers, Dead or Alive II), Play’n GO (Book of Dead, Reactoonz), and ELK Studios. These games offer a better statistical return and more predictable bankroll depletion rates. Specifically avoid game categories with inherently low RTPs, such as most online scratch cards, some keno variants, and certain branded slots with RTPs configured below 94%. For table games, stick to Blackjack (using perfect basic strategy) and European Roulette, avoiding American Roulette (with its double-zero) and side bets with high house edges.

Need to Know

What should I do if I can’t log in?

First, clear your browser cache and cookies, then attempt to log in again. If the issue persists, use the ‘Forgot Password’ function to reset your credentials. Ensure you are not using a VPN or proxy service, as these can be blocked by the casino’s geolocation filters.

How long does the KYC verification process take?

Verification typically takes between 12 to 48 hours after you have submitted all required, clear documents. Delays usually occur due to blurry photos, incomplete documents, or mismatched information between your account and your ID.

Why was my withdrawal declined or reversed?

The most common reasons are attempting to withdraw before meeting active bonus wagering requirements, withdrawing to a method not used for deposit, or triggering a security review that requires additional verification documentation.

Can I play on multiple devices?

Yes, you can typically access your account from different devices. However, most platforms enforce a single active session rule. Logging in on a new device will usually log you out of any previous session.

Are there fees for deposits or withdrawals?

The casino generally does not charge fees, but your payment provider (e.g., your bank, e-wallet, or card issuer) might impose transaction or currency conversion fees. Always check with your provider.

What happens if my game disconnects during a round?

Modern casino games are server-side. If you disconnect, the round completes on the game server. Upon reconnecting and loading the game, it should sync and show the result. If your balance doesn’t update, check your transaction history or contact support with the game round ID.

How do I set deposit limits?

Responsible gambling tools, including deposit, loss, and wager limits, are found in your account settings under a section often labeled ‘Responsible Gaming’ or ‘Play Safe’. Limits can usually be set for daily, weekly, or monthly periods and take effect immediately.

Is there a dedicated mobile application?

The platform is accessed via a fully mobile-optimized website that functions like an app. For an app-like experience, you can often add the website to your device’s home screen as a Progressive Web App (PWA), which launches in a dedicated browser window.

Operating a modern iGaming account requires a systematic approach, treating it as a technical system with defined inputs, processes, and outputs. By understanding the underlying mechanics—from the encryption securing your login to the mathematical models defining bonus value—you shift from passive play to active platform management. This guide provides the foundational protocol; consistent application of these procedures will lead to more secure, efficient, and informed interaction with the casino’s ecosystem. Always prioritize the configuration of security settings and a thorough review of operational terms before engaging in financial transactions.